How To Choose The Best Cement For Stepping Stones
Stepping stone cement demands a different performance profile than foundation concrete. You need a formula that flows into detailed molds, hardens fast enough to demold the same day, and resists shrinkage cracking as it cures. Here is what matters most.
Setting Time and Workability
For stone molds, a setting window of 15 to 30 minutes is ideal. Slower-curing standard concrete traps you in a full-day wait before demolding, and the mix can separate in thin pours. Fast-setting hydraulic cements harden in under 20 minutes, which lets you batch small mixes and keep your workflow moving without rushing.
Compression Strength and Density
Stepping stones are exposed to point loads from heels, dropped tools, and freeze-thaw cycles. You want a cured compression strength of at least 4,000 PSI. Mixes that yield a dense, non-chalky surface resist chipping and surface wear far longer than softer blends. Check the manufacturer’s PSI at one-hour and full-cure marks.
Shrinkage and Crack Resistance
Thin-section pours (under 1 inch) are especially vulnerable to hairline cracks during curing. Non-shrink hydraulic cements eliminate this risk entirely. Standard concrete mix shrinks as water evaporates, which causes edge cracks in decorative molds. For stepping stones, always prioritize a product labeled non-shrink or zero-shrink.

Hardware & Specs Guide
Hydraulic vs. Standard Concrete Mix
Hydraulic cements (like Rockite) contain compounds that react with water to form crystals, locking the structure in place with zero drying shrinkage. Standard concrete mix uses Portland cement with sand and gravel aggregate, which naturally shrinks as water evaporates. For stepping stones that are often poured under 1 inch thick, hydraulic formulas prevent hairline edge cracks that ruin the stone’s shape and weaken its structure over time.
Compression Strength and Load Tolerance
Compression strength is measured in PSI (pounds per square inch) at specific cure times. A target of at least 4,000 PSI at full cure ensures the stepping stone can handle adult foot traffic and seasonal freeze-thaw cycles without crumbling. Fast-setting hydraulic cements often hit 4,500 PSI in just one hour, while standard all-purpose mixes may take 24 hours to reach similar strength. The faster cure also reduces the chance of weather damage if you are pouring outdoors.
Mold Release and Surface Finish
Silicone molds release non-shrink hydraulic cement more easily than standard concrete because the mix does not pull away from edges during cure. For a polished finish, use a fine-grind powder like ResinCrete that fills every micro-detail of the mold. Standard aggregate mixes leave a matte, slightly rough surface that works for rustic stepping stones but struggles with fine patterns. If your mold has deep grooves or letters, a hydraulic or mineral compound is the only reliable choice.
